Well all though the core speed of the 6800gt is lower than the x800xl they are pretty much on par with each other. They get roughly the same 3d mark 05 score. The only significant difference is with hl2 and doom3 (where the x800xl is king with hl2 and the 6800gt is king with doom3). The only major difference between the two is that the 6800 has sm3 whilst the x800 doesnt, but the x800 is also cheaper. Heres a comparison chart that has both the graphics cards in it (
link). It shows how both perform. Hope this helps.